Has anyone figured out how to pronounce his name yet? I guess since all the announcers call him "Kopetsky" that must be it, but then I wonder...why not just spell it that way? Haha.

"Kopetsky" would be correct. In many Slavic languages, the letter 'c' without an accent makes a 'ts' sound. So Kopecky would sound like "Kopetsky"
